Chaz and AJ dove into the shocking shooting incident at the White House Correspondents’ Dinner, unpacking how something like this could happen in such a high-profile, tightly secured setting—and, of course, the bizarre moment that had everyone asking why the suspect put his mouth on that carpet!To break it all down, they were joined by former Secret Service agent Paul Eckloff, who has protected Presidents George W. Bush, Barack Obama, and Donald Trump over his 23 year career, and has been inside that very ballroom multiple times, offering firsthand insight into the security realities of the event.Later, they spoke with retired Chief of Detectives for the Hartford Police Department Brian Foley, who helped make sense of the unfolding details and what law enforcement looks for in moments like these.Photo: Credit: REUTERS
